Understanding the Mechanics of Predictive Markets

Predictive markets, like those offered through kalshi, allow users to buy and sell contracts based on the outcome of future events. These contracts represent a stake in the probability of a specific event occurring. For example, a contract might be created for the outcome of an upcoming election, a major economic indicator, or even the success of a new product launch. The price of the contract fluctuates based on supply and demand, reflecting the collective beliefs of the participants. If more people believe an event will happen, the price of the 'yes' contract will rise, and vice versa. This dynamic price discovery is a key feature of these markets.

The ability to both buy and sell contracts is crucial. It’s not simply about predicting the outcome; it’s about managing risk and expressing nuanced opinions. A user who believes an event is unlikely might sell a 'yes' contract to profit if the event doesn't occur. Conversely, someone believing an event is highly probable might buy a 'yes' contract hoping to profit from its eventual fulfillment. This creates a constant flow of information and a more accurate representation of collective belief than static polls or surveys. The market effectively distills complex information into a single, easily interpretable price.

The Role of Incentives and Market Liquidity

The financial incentives inherent in these markets play a critical role in their predictive power. When participants have ‘skin in the game,’ they are more motivated to analyze information carefully and make informed decisions. This reduces the likelihood of biased or uninformed predictions. Furthermore, market liquidity – the ease with which contracts can be bought and sold – is essential. Higher liquidity means more participants, more informed trading, and a more accurate reflection of the underlying probabilities. Platforms actively work to attract a diverse range of participants to foster this liquidity.

Regulations are also a vital component. Proper oversight helps ensure fair trading practices and prevents manipulative behavior. Without appropriate safeguards, the accuracy and integrity of the market could be compromised. The regulatory landscape for these markets is still developing, but the goal is to create a framework that encourages participation while protecting against abuse. This requires a delicate balance between innovation and risk management.

The Predictive Power of Decentralized Forecasting

The decentralized nature of these markets is a key strength. There’s no central authority dictating the ‘correct’ prediction. Instead, the market derives its wisdom from the collective actions of its participants. This reduces the risk of groupthink and allows for a more objective assessment of probabilities. Furthermore, the financial incentives encourage participants to actively seek out and incorporate new information into their decision-making process. This constant refinement of predictions is a hallmark of effective forecasting.

The difference between how these markets function and traditional polling methods is significant. Polls are subject to sampling bias, question wording effects, and the strategic behavior of respondents. Markets, on the other hand, are incentivized to be accurate. Participants lose money if their predictions are wrong, providing a powerful incentive to be informed and rational. This makes market-based forecasting a potentially more reliable tool for understanding future political outcomes, although it is still not without its limitations.
